word expressing a sudden feeling

A short word like “oh!” or “wow!” that shows a feeling.

Padron ng paggamit: an interjection (such as [word])
Karaniwang pagkakamali:
Learners may confuse interjections with exclamations in general; an interjection is a type of word/phrase, not just the punctuation mark (!).

brief interrupting remark

A short comment that interrupts someone.

Padron ng paggamit: make an interjection (about [topic])
Karaniwang pagkakamali:
Do not confuse this noun sense with the verb interject (to interrupt by speaking).
